The Hidden Danger of Creosote Accumulation

Every time you light a fire in your hearth, a complex chemical process takes place. As wood burns, it releases volatile gases, water vapor, and unburned carbon particles. When these substances travel up the relatively cooler flue, they condense along the inner walls. This condensation hardens into a highly flammable, tar-like substance known as creosote.

Creosote develops in three distinct stages, each progressively more dangerous and difficult to remove.

  • Stage One: This manifests as a flaky, dusty layer of soot that can be easily brushed away during a standard sweep.
  • Stage Two: The deposit transforms into a crunchy, tar-like flake that adheres firmly to the masonry.
  • Stage Three: This is the most critical phase, where the creosote bakes into a dense, glossy, highly concentrated fuel source that coats the flue liner like hardened glaze.

If a stray spark contacts a stage-three creosote deposit, it can ignite a chimney fire that reaches temperatures exceeding 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it, capable of melting steel liners and cracking thick brickwork within minutes.

Understanding how different wood types accelerate this accumulation can help you minimize the risks between professional sweepings. Softwoods, such as pine or cedar, contain high amounts of sap and resin. When burned, they create rapid heat but generate significantly more unburned particulate matter, speeding up the rate of creosote formation. Hardwoods like oak, maple, and hickory burn slower, hotter, and cleaner, provided they have been seasoned properly. Seasoned wood refers to logs that have been split and dried for at least six to twelve months, bringing the internal moisture content below twenty percent. Burning unseasoned, green wood forces the fire to waste energy boiling off internal water, which cools the smoke and causes rapid condensation along the flue walls.

Recognizing Structural Deterioration and Flue Failures

The external masonry of your hearth system constantly battles the elements, making it susceptible to moisture intrusion and thermal shock. Water is the primary enemy of brick and mortar. During the cold winter months, moisture seeps into the porous bricks and the mortar joints. When the temperature drops below freezing, this trapped water expands, microscopic fractures widen, and the structural bonds begin to fail. This cycle, known as the freeze-thaw effect, eventually causes the faces of the bricks to pop off, a destructive process called spalling.

Inside the chimney, the flue liner bears the brunt of intense thermal fluctuations. Liners made of clay tiles can crack over time due to sudden temperature spikes, while older metal liners can corrode from the acidic bypass gasses produced by oil or gas furnaces. A single crack in a flue liner allows extreme heat to transfer directly to the combustible wooden framing of your home. Furthermore, a compromised liner allows carbon monoxide to seep through the masonry walls and enter living spaces, posing a lethal threat to everyone inside.

Protecting your roofing framework and interior walls requires proactive vigilance. Homeowners should look out for falling debris in the firebox, cracked mortar joints along the roofline, and white, powdery staining on the exterior brickwork, which indicates that salt-laden moisture is migrating through the masonry. Proactive Preservation and Seasonal Maintenance Strategy

Preserving your heating system involves a combination of smart burning habits and scheduled professional oversight. To keep your flue running efficiently, always verify that the damper is fully open before lighting a fire, and never use your hearth as an incinerator for household trash, cardboard, or plastics. Burning treated lumber or garbage releases highly corrosive chemicals that degrade metal liners instantly and release toxic fumes into the surrounding neighborhood. Installing a high-quality stainless steel cap over the flue opening is another excellent preventative measure, as it keeps out rain, snow, and nesting animals while acting as a spark arrestor to protect your roof.

Even with flawless burning habits, structural movement and subtle shifting can introduce hazards that only an expert eye can capture. An annual inspection is non-negotiable for identifying underlying draft imbalances, hidden creosote layers, and chimney cap deterioration.
